Title Alliance, a joint venture title insurance company, appointed Kelly Stevens as corporate attorney, Tracey Elliot as processor and Melissa Perkins as a post closer at its Maine location. Perkins began to work in the title industry in 1997.

“Melissa’s attention to detail acts as an extra set of eyes to make sure all ‘i’s are dotted and ‘t’s are crossed,” Title Alliance of Maine Director of Operations Amy Devine said. “Having her in the office will helps us to handle a much higher volume, which is timely as the spring market is already kicking in.”
Elliott joins the team with more than 15 years of experience in all aspects of the closing process. She has experience opening orders, clearing title commitments and processing HUD statements.
“Tracy’s well-rounded experience and go-getter attitude made me confident that she was a good fit,” Title Alliance Regional Director Jadah Hill said. “Her commitment to exceptional customer service was apparent, and I know she’s going to help this team continue to grow.”
Stevens graduated from the University of Maine Law School in 2001 and has practiced in the title and settlement industry since 2002. She serves as a member of the American Land Title Association, sits on the board of directors for hoMEworks where she educates first-time homebuyers, and sits on the University of Southern Maine Institutional Review Board. Stevens is admitted to practice law in Maine and New Hampshire.
“Kelly’s professional resume, and incredible knowledge base regarding the industry and law, will really pull the team together,” Hill said. “Customers can feel confident that Kelly understands their needs and can address them quickly and professionally.”
